What Massachusetts Employers Look For

The qualifications that appear most often in department supervisor jobs across Massachusetts.

  • Three or more years of direct supervisory or team-lead experience in a relevant department
  • Demonstrated ability to manage schedules, performance reviews, and staff development
  • Proficiency with inventory or workforce management systems used in Massachusetts operations
  • Strong communication skills for coordinating across departments and reporting to senior management
  • Familiarity with Massachusetts workplace safety standards and relevant OSHA compliance requirements
  • Associate or bachelor's degree in business, operations, or a field related to the industry

How do you become a department supervisor in Massachusetts?

Most department supervisors in Massachusetts advance through demonstrated performance in frontline or team-lead roles rather than a state-issued license. The typical path starts with gaining experience in your industry, whether retail, healthcare operations, manufacturing, or logistics, then moving into a lead or assistant supervisor position. Massachusetts employers generally look for candidates who have managed direct reports, handled scheduling, and can show measurable results in their department before stepping into a full supervisory role.

How can I get hired as a department supervisor in Massachusetts with little or no experience?

The most realistic entry point is a frontline or team-lead role in your target industry. Large Massachusetts employers like Mass General Brigham, TJX Companies, and major logistics operators regularly hire associates and coordinators into roles that build the supervisory skills needed to move up. Pursuing a relevant associate degree, a CompTIA or OSHA certification, or a SHRM certificate signals readiness for the step up. Starting as a shift lead, department lead, or assistant supervisor is the bridge most Massachusetts employers expect candidates to cross first.
